4887 Jacques de Sève – Le Loup – Copperplate Engraving from Buffon’s Histoire Naturelle (18th Century)

This original 18th-century copperplate engraving titled Le Loup (The Wolf) was drawn by Jacques de Sève for Georges-Louis Leclerc de Buffon’s celebrated Histoire Naturelle. It presents the European grey wolf in a naturalistic landscape with distant hills and detailed foreground flora, emphasizing the animal’s anatomical accuracy and natural majesty.
Jacques de Sève (active 1740s–1780s) served as one of Buffon’s chief illustrators, known for pairing zoological precision with elegant and scenic settings in his compositions. These engravings formed part of one of the most influential natural history encyclopedias of the Enlightenment.
